FLEX 10KE Embedded Programmable Logic Devices Data Sheet
14
When used as RAM, each EAB can be configured in any of the following
sizes: 256 16, 512 8, 1,024 4, or 2,048
Figure 5. FLEX 10KE EAB Memory Configurations
Larger blocks of RAM are created by combining multiple EABs. For
example, two 256 16 RAM blocks can be combined to form a 256 32
block; two 512 8 RAM blocks can be combined to form a 512
(see
Figure 6. Examples of Combining FLEX 10KE EABs
If necessary, all EABs in a device can be cascaded to form a single RAM
block. EABs can be cascaded to form RAM blocks of up to 2,048 words
without impacting timing. The Altera software automatically combines
EABs to meet a designer’s RAM specifications.
